Abstract

The present invention provides a pancreas induced in vitro that is useful for developmental engineering and organ engineering, and a method wherein a pancreas induced in vitro which contributes to the development of diagnosis and treatment of pancreatic disorders for higher animals, can artificially and efficiently be induced from a gastrula apart from the presumptive region of pancreas. An explant which has a secretory gland-like structure wherein several cells are gathered and which expresses insulin is formed in vitro by treating the blastopore upper lip of an early gastrula of a vertebrate such aswith retinoic acid in vitro, and then culturing. The treatment with retinoic acid can be carried out, for example, by treating with retinoic acid at a concentration of 10M or above for three hours.
